Output 4453c6d79ddc45663a429121865401bf2613ad4b04e904ab111d83c339b21db3:3

value
58838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a405de3faf4e84b3bf78278ef3a62185620ed9 OP_EQUAL
address
3HhifdHtXAPLdhsv3unBYSUV7AKmngAzMr
transaction
4453c6d79ddc45663a429121865401bf2613ad4b04e904ab111d83c339b21db3
spent
true